William,

Basically, you are allowed to take your clothing into the test, that's it.
Pencils, a calculator (one of those non-HP type that mess me up since I'm a
nerd engineer who really like Reverse Polish Notation!), and scrap paper are
provided.

Additionally, you are not allowed to write anything down anywhere until the
test starts, so you need to have those formulas memorized for at least about
15 minutes while the proctor goes through the instructions.

The way I learned to memorize the trig functions as a kid was through a
stupid saying:

Oliver Holds Ancient Hats Over Apples

That's O/H (= Sin), A/H (=Cos), O/A (=Tan).

Believe me, I use this mnemonic almost every day. All the other formulas are
simply derived from these.

And if these formulas are the worst of your fears, you'll do fine.

Friends:

I have a question about the trigonometry portion of the test:

I enjoy mathematics, I use it every day and I consider myself somewhat good
at it.  I do have common formulas in my palm pilot as well as the
scientific calculator.  I would consider it wrong headed to require test
participants to memorize trig. formulas.  There is only so much room in one
brain, and I think it unwise to clutter it with information easily found in
a handy reference.  Give me any triangle and my notes and a cacluator.and I
will analyses it.  Deprive me of my basic notes, and I am lost.

Below is the sum total of the notes I would need.  Would I be allowed to
take these and my scientific calculator into the test?

Will I be allowed plenty of scratch paper?  I am a graphic oriented
thinker, and I can work out complex problems, but I need to draw myself a
picture!

William Miller



Trig functions:
SIN A=OPP/HYP
SIN A * HYP = OPP

TAN A = OPP/ADJ
TAN A * ADJ  = OPP

TAN -1  OPP/ADJ  =  A

COS A = ADJ/HYP
COSA*HYP=ADJ
COS-1 ADJ/HYP  = A
